Study/개발지식

블록체인 기술 및 무선 메시 네트워크

AC 2021. 12. 18. 22:41

 

보다 포괄적인 구조에 대한 요구가 계속 증가하고 있습니다. 우리 중 많은 사람들이 커뮤니티와 사회적 통합의 필요성을 인식하기 시작했습니다. 인터넷이 우리를 하나로 뭉치게 하는지, 아니면 갈라지게 하는지에 대한 논쟁은 항상 끝나지 않을 것입니다. 그러나 우리는 디지털 시대에 살고 있기 때문에 인터넷은 최근 이러한 변화와 세계화 및 지속 가능한 커뮤니티에 대한 요구의 중심에 있었습니다.

돌아 오라의의 트렌디 한 단어 r은 먹고 기술의 세계는 다음과 같습니다, "지방 분권"을 "민주화", "금융 포함"과 "커뮤니티". 요즘 사람들의 관심을 받기 위해서는 브랜드가 포용성이나 평등성을 팔아야 하는 것은 당연합니다. Fin-Tech 공간은 더 많은 사람들이 재정적으로 포함될 수 있도록 돕고자 하는 회사로 가득 차 있고  , 다른 분야도 잠재 고객에게 커뮤니티의 일부가 되는 것이 엄청난 혜택을 줄 결정이라고 말합니다.

그러나 이러한 선의의 행동이나 PR에도 불구하고 우리는 여전히 사회적 포용과 탈중앙화와는 거리가 멉니다. 소수의 기술 솔루션만이 인류에게 세계가 민주화될 수 있다는 희망을 줄 수 있었습니다.

Blockchain 기술, Cryptocurrency, NFT  DeFi  같은 분산 솔루션 은 우리가 요구하는 분산되고 포용적인 세계에 가장 가까운 솔루션입니다. 금융, 예술, 데이터 개인 정보 보호 및 보안 분야의 사람들에게 완전히 동등한 액세스 권한과 권한을 부여함으로써 이러한 플랫폼은 모두 분산되고 포용적인 세상의 가능성을 엿볼 수 있었습니다.

그러나 앞서 언급했듯이 인터넷은 오늘날 문자 그대로 모든 솔루션의 중심에 있으며 위에서 언급한 이러한 분산 솔루션은 모두 디지털 솔루션입니다. 따라서 들어오는 솔루션도 동일한 경로를 따를 것이며 이는 분산되고 포용적인 세계에 대한 우리의 좋은 의도에도 불구하고 예측된 세계의 지속 가능성은 인터넷과 더 많은 사람들이 인터넷을 사용하도록 하는 방법에 달려 있음을 의미합니다. 그것의 네트워크.

지역 및 글로벌 참여는 사람들이 사용할 수 있는 네트워크 인프라에 크게 의존합니다. 더 많은 사람들이 인류를 위해 준비된 잠재적 솔루션을 활용할 수 있도록 통신 네트워크를 개선하고 저렴한 인터넷 인프라를 제공할 필요가 있습니다.

블록체인 기술은 이미 널리 수용되는 기술 솔루션이 되었으며 그 적용이 날로 증가하고 있습니다. 블록체인은 가장 인기 있는 암호화폐의 기반 기술인 비트코인에 의해 대중화되었습니다 . 블록체인 기술은 암호 화폐에 처음 적용된 이후 여러 가지 다른 방식으로 적용되었으며 여전히 기술의 추가 적용에 대한 요구가 증가하고 있습니다.

분산 원장이라고도 하는 블록체인 기술은 블록에 불변 정보를 포함하는 P2P 네트워크입니다. 단일 블록에는 네트워크의 모든 피어의 허가 없이는 변경할 수 없는 정보가 포함됩니다. 이는 한 블록에 있는 모든 정보의 해시가 다음 블록에 포함되기 때문에 모든 블록이 함께 연결되고 한 블록을 변조하면 해당 체인의 모든 블록 내용이 교란되기 때문에 가능합니다.

블록체인에서 데이터의 불변성 외에도 블록체인 기술의 분산된 특성은 데이터 개인 정보 보호 및 보안에도 유용합니다. 블록체인 기술은 사람들이 자신의 신원을 숨긴 상태로 네트워크에 가입할 수 있도록 하며 거래나 커뮤니케이션을 용이하게 하는 중앙 기관의 필요성을 우회합니다. 이에 대한 가장 일반적이고 일반적인 예는 암호화폐에 블록체인을 적용하는 것입니다. 블록체인 기술의 도움으로 암호화폐는 은행과 같은 중앙 기관 없이 금융 거래가 이루어지기 때문에 탈중앙화의 가장 좋은 예 중 하나가 되었습니다 .

반면에 WMN(Wireless Mesh Networks) 은 네트워크 인프라에 대한 동등하고 공유된 액세스 권한을 가진 사람들의 커뮤니티를 포함하는 분산 액세스 네트워크입니다 . 이러한 네트워크는 이러한 네트워크를 공유하는 사람들에 의한 리소스 풀링을 포함하므로 중립적이고 포괄적이라는 특징이 있습니다.

WMN(무선 메시 네트워크)은 무선 메시 라우터, 무선 메시 클라이언트 및 네트워크 게이트웨이와 같은 무선 노드로 구성됩니다. 자체 조직화되고 새로운 네트워크 링크를 추가하여 도달 범위를 늘릴 수 있기 때문에 유기적으로 성장할 수 있습니다 . 사람(클라이언트)은 메시 라우터 또는 Wi-Fi를 통해 연결하고 무선 메시 네트워크를 사용하여 인터넷에 액세스할 수 있습니다.

WMN은 중앙 계획이나 조직이 필요하지 않고 로컬 결정에 의해 함께 풀링되는 라우터와 링크에만 의존하기 때문에 분산 네트워크입니다 . 이 상호 연결에 필요한 것은 주기적으로 최적의 네트워크 경로를 식별한 후 라우팅 프로토콜을 채택하는 것입니다.

WMN(Wireless Mesh Networks) 인프라는 인터넷에 액세스할 수 없는 나머지 인류를 연결하기 위한 가능한 솔루션으로 선전되었습니다 . 네트워크의 분산되고 공동적인 특성은 더 많은 커뮤니티 액세스 네트워크를 구축하는 데 사용될 수 있다고 믿어집니다. 이러한 네트워크는 이미 존재하며 커뮤니티 구성원의 수는 매우 유망합니다. Guifi 네트워크(Guifi.net)는 무선 메시 네트워크의 전형적인 예입니다. 이미 커뮤니티에 약 34,000개의 참여 라우터가 있습니다.

그러나 신뢰와 지속 가능성은 Wireless Mesh Networks와 관련된 주요 문제입니다. 현재 모델은 각 참가자의 소비와 기여도를 기록하여 소비와 기여도의 균형을 유지하는 것을 포함합니다. 예를 들어, 소비에 비해 부정적인 기여를 한 참가자는 더 많이 기여한 다른 참가자를 보상해야 합니다. 이것은 지역 사회에 공정성과 평등이 있음을 보장하기 위해 수행됩니다 . 그러나 문제는 이러한 레코드가 수동으로 수집되고 변경되지 않는다는 것입니다.

모든 참가자는 비용과 소비를 기록하고 주기적으로 선언합니다. 이러한 기록은 WMN 네트워크 트래픽 측정과 비교됩니다. 상관 관계가 없는 경우 두 레코드에 모두 플래그가 지정되고 분쟁 해결 메커니즘이 마련되어 있습니다. 멋있게 들릴지 모르지만 이 방법은 수많은 충돌의 대상이 될 수 있으며 또한 Wireless Mesh Networks의 지속 가능성과 향후 확장을 위협할 수 있습니다. 따라서 불변하고 지속 가능한 데이터를 기록하기 위한 구조를 통합할 필요가 있다. 통합될 이 기술 솔루션은 또한 Wireless Mesh Networks의 주요 기능인 분산이 손상되지 않도록 보장해야 합니다.

따라서 블록체인 기술과 무선 메시 네트워크의 통합을 사용하여 커뮤니티의 신뢰를 높이고 액세스 네트워크의 지속 가능성을 높일 수 있습니다. 이는 블록체인 기술이 분산 원장 역할을 하기 때문에 가능합니다. 분산 원장의 개념은 모든 트랜잭션이 기록되고 모든 참가자가 이러한 변경 불가능한 원장의 동일한 복사본을 갖는다는 것 입니다.

두 솔루션 통합

분산 액세스 네트워크와 블록체인 솔루션의 통합은 네트워크가 달성하기 위해 구축한 핵심 가치를 잃지 않고 이루어져야 합니다. 블록체인 솔루션은 퍼즐의 두 번째 조각으로 간주되어야 하며 액세스 네트워크의 효율성을 개선하도록 설계되어야 합니다. 무선 메시 네트워크는 경제적으로 자립하고 신뢰할 수 있으며 포괄적인 동시에 더 쉬운 인터넷 연결을 보장해야 합니다.

따라서 블록체인 솔루션의 요소와 기능을 신중하게 선택하고 기존 메시 액세스 네트워크에 통합해야 합니다. 블록체인 솔루션의 핵심을 이루는 불변성을 제외하고, 허가와 프라이버시의 개념을 광범위하게 고려해야 합니다.

무허가 블록체인을 사용하면 누구나 네트워크의 일부가 될 수 있고 네트워크의 다른 엔터티 또는 구성원과 협력할 수 있습니다 . 이는 모든 사람이 네트워크에서 "쓰기 액세스" 권한이 있음을 의미합니다. 비트코인과 이더리움은 누구나 네트워크에 가입하고, 네트워크에서 거래하고, 채굴과 같은 다른 작업을 수행할 수 있기 때문에 권한이 없는 블록체인의 고전적인 예입니다.

반면, 허가형 블록체인은 더 ​​엄격한 작동 모드를 가지고 있습니다. 회사나 서비스 제공자가 고객을 알아야 하는 비즈니스 애플리케이션(특히 금융)에서 주로 사용됩니다. KYC(Know Your Customer)는 특정 비즈니스 운영에서 가장 중요한 것으로 간주되며 허가된 블록체인은 블록체인이 제공하는 데이터 불변성을 활용하려는 솔루션과 통합됩니다.

또한 프라이버시와 관련하여 블록체인 솔루션은 퍼블릭 블록체인 또는 프라이빗 블록체인으로 설명할 수 있습니다. 블록체인 데이터가 대중에게 공개되면 공개라고 하고 데이터에 대한 접근이 금지된 경우에는 비공개라고 합니다.

따라서 블록체인 솔루션을 메시 액세스 네트워크와 통합할 때 데이터 프라이버시와 불변성을 보다 지속 가능하고 신뢰할 수 있도록 보장할 필요가 있습니다. 따라서 WMN(Wireless Mesh Networks)에는 사설 허가형 블록체인을 권장합니다.

따라서 이 통합에 적합한 플랫폼을 선택하는 것이 매우 중요합니다. 앞서 확인했듯이 블록체인 플랫폼은 개인 권한 작업을 활성화해야 합니다. 이더리움과 HLF(Hyper Ledger Fabric)는 이 목표를 달성하기 위한 두 가지 가능한 블록체인 네트워크입니다.

HLF(Hyper Ledger Fabric)는 허가된 블록체인 네트워크의 모듈식 오픈 소스 구현입니다. 모듈화를 통해 구성 요소 및 기능의 동적 구현을 ​​지원할 수 있습니다 . Go 및 Java와 같은 범용 프로그래밍 언어로 작성된 분산 응용 프로그램은 HLF(Hyper Ledger Fabric)를 사용하여 실행할 수 있습니다. HLF를 사용하면 거래하는 구성원 피어 집합 간에 완벽한 기밀성을 유지할 수 있습니다. 폐쇄되고 허가된 버전의 블록체인은 여러 채널 및 특정 체인 코드 또는 분산 응용 프로그램의 구성원을 그룹화하여 플랫폼에서 홍보합니다.

HLF "주문 서비스" 구성 요소는 비트코인의 작업 증명(POW)과 유사합니다 . 블록체인 상태에 대한 합의는 주문 서비스 수준에서 발생합니다. 트랜잭션을 시간순으로 정렬하고 네트워크의 피어에게 브로드캐스트되는 새 트랜잭션 블록을 생성하여 서비스 기능을 주문하고, 피어는 이 블록을 블록체인의 로컬 복사본에 추가합니다.

반면  이더리움은 공개 또는 비공개 애플리케이션을 구축하는 데 활용할 수 있는 오픈 소스 블록체인 플랫폼입니다. 이러한 응용 프로그램은 컴퓨터에서 실행되도록 소프트웨어를 개발하는 것과 마찬가지로 컴퓨터에서 실행됩니다. 이를 '분권화된 애플리케이션'을 의미하는 'Dapps'라고 합니다.

일부 사람들에게 이더리움은 가장 가치 있고 인기 있는 암호화폐 중 하나로 알려져 있습니다. 그들은 비트코인 ​​다음으로 두 번째로 가치 있는 가상 화폐로 알고 있습니다. 그러나 Ethereum은 암호 화폐 이상이며 일부 사람들은 이것을 현대 기술 역사상 가장 중요한 혁신 중 하나로 설명할 수도 있습니다. Ethereum은 Bitcoin  같은 상품의 매매와 같은 여러 다른 솔루션에 사용되었으며  분산 금융(Defi)의 성장에서 주요 구성 요소로 사용되었습니다.

이더리움 플랫폼은 공개 블록체인이지만 개발자는 참여 노드가 제한된 비공개 권한 네트워크를 배포할 수 있습니다. 이것은 이더리움의 핵심 소프트웨어 플랫폼이 오픈 소스이고 튜링이 완전하기 때문에 가능합니다.

이더리움 가상 머신(EVM)은 이더리움 플랫폼의 중요한 측면을 형성합니다. EVM은 이더리움 프로토콜을 구현하고 이더리움 스마트 계약을 실행할 책임이 있습니다.  이더리움 프로토콜은 중앙 또는 제3자의 필요 없이 이더리움에서 상태 전환 및 계산을 가능하게 하는 것입니다.

스마트 계약은 일반적으로 solidity와 같은 특정 프로그래밍 언어를 사용하여 개발된 계약입니다. 블록체인 네트워크에 배포되면 스마트 계약에 고유한 주소가 할당됩니다. 스마트 계약과 외부 소유 계정(EOA)은 둘 다 거래 촉진을 위한 주소 할당을 포함하기 때문에 이더리움 생태계의 주요 실체를 형성합니다 . 스마트 컨트랙트 주소와 EOA가 트랜잭션을 할 때마다 이더리움 가상 머신의 상태가 변경됩니다. 그러나 이더리움 네트워크에서는 이러한 코드나 트랜잭션이 호출될 때마다 네트워크의 모든 노드가 정확한 유형의 코드를 실행합니다. 따라서 해당 상태 변경은 모든 원장에 분산되고 변경할 수 없는 방식으로 기록됩니다.

이러한 블록체인 솔루션 중 어느 것이 다른 솔루션보다 우선되어야 하는지를 지정하는 것은 어렵습니다. Ethereum과 HLF(Hyper Ledger Fabric)의 주요 차이점은 각각 허가형 블록체인 패러다임과 개방형 블록체인 패러다임을 채택하는 접근 방식입니다. HLF는 폐쇄적이고 허가된 블록체인 버전을 달성하기 위해 보다 엄격한 접근 방식을 채택합니다. 선택된 구성원의 피어 간의 기밀성을 보장하고 채널, 연결된 체인 코드 또는 분산 응용 프로그램으로 그룹화하여 이를 수행합니다. 반면에 이더리움은 블록체인 솔루션으로서 보다 개방적인 접근 방식을 취하고 플랫폼에서 분산 애플리케이션의 자동화 및 구축을 가능하게 하는 것 같습니다.

그러나 가장 중요한 것은 기능 및 작동 또는 실행 모드에 대한 자세한 설명에서 HLF(Hyper Ledger Fabric)와 Ethereum 플랫폼이 모두 통합되어야 하는 기능과 역동성을 가진 블록체인 지원 솔루션이라는 것입니다. 메쉬 액세스 네트워크로. 이러한 블록체인 솔루션은 또한 지속 가능하고 포괄적이며 신뢰할 수 있는 액세스 네트워크를 구축하는 데 필요한 정확한 품질을 보여줍니다.

미래는 무엇을 의미합니까?

혁신과 발명이 빠른 속도로 계속 진행되기 때문에 기술 공간에서 어떤 일이 일어날지 예측하는 것이 점점 더 어려워지고 있습니다. 우리가 할 수 있는 최선은 최근 동향과 요구 사항을 살펴보는 것입니다. 지속적인 사회적 추세는 기술 솔루션이 어디에 적합할 수 있는지에 대한 포인터가 될 수 있으며 사람들의 요구 사항은 기술 솔루션 제공자가 집중해야 하는 부분에 대한 지표가 될 수도 있습니다.

최근 경향은 커뮤니티와 사회적 포용으로의 전환을 나타냅니다. 사람들이 자신의 관심사에 맞는 커뮤니티에 속하거나 찾을 수 있도록 돕는 기술 솔루션이 증가하고 있습니다. 소셜 미디어 플랫폼 외에도 더 많은 디지털 플랫폼이 온라인 커뮤니티 또는 '부족'을 구축하는 방법을 찾고 있습니다.

반면에 보다 분산되고 데이터를 보호하는 플랫폼에 대한 수요도 증가하고 있습니다. 더 많은 사람들이 기술 회사와 공공 기관이 데이터를 사용하는 방식에 대해 걱정하고 있습니다. 데이터 조작, 사회 공학 및 온라인 사기 행위에 대한 보고가 증가함에 따라 점점 더 중요한 문제가 되고 있습니다. 개선된 데이터 관리 솔루션에 대한 이러한 요구는 암호화폐, 블록체인 기술 및 유사한 보안 플랫폼의 혁신으로 충족되었습니다.

따라서 이더리움과 같은 메쉬 액세스 네트워크와 블록체인 솔루션의 통합은 최근의 추세와 수요에 거의 완벽합니다. 이 솔루션은 신뢰할 수 있고 안전한 프로세스를 통해 분산 액세스 네트워크를 제공합니다. 그것은 인터넷의 지속 가능한 사용을 장려할 것입니다.

메시 액세스 네트워크의 채택은 신뢰할 수 있는 프로세스의 부족으로 인해 위협을 받았습니다. 변조에 대한 데이터의 취약성과 효과적인 데이터 및 기록 시스템의 부족은 이러한 커뮤니티 네트워크가 여전히 일부 사람들에 의해 의심되는 주요 이유이자 잠재력에 도달하지 못한 이유였습니다.

그러나 메쉬 액세스 네트워크와 블록체인 기술의 통합으로 마침내 지속 가능한 경제 네트워크 커뮤니티에 접근할 수 있습니다. 이 혁신은 통신 산업을 변화시키고 우리가 네트워크를 만들고 공유하는 방식에 혁명을 일으킬 것입니다. 블록체인 지원 솔루션의 등장으로 그 꿈이 현실이 될 수 있는 플랫폼이 만들어졌기 때문에 커뮤니티 액세스 네트워크의 꿈은 더 이상 꿈으로 남아 있을 필요가 없습니다.

LIST